Hjerkinn Weather in July

July in Hjerkinn sees daytime temperatures around 15°C (59°F) and lows of 6°C (43°F) at night. As the wettest month of the year, keep in mind that rainfall is at its highest.

Rainfall in Hjerkinn in July

This month is known for heavy rainfall, so don't forget your umbrella to stay dry. This month experiences about 18 days of rain according to historical data, averaging 117 mm (4.6 in). Expect frequent rainfall this month, and not just light drizzle. When it rains, it tends to come down hard.

Temperature in Hjerkinn in July

In July, expect moderate temperatures in Hjerkinn, with highs of 15°C (59°F) and lows of 6°C (43°F) at night. July is part of summer. This creates a mild day-to-night pattern that is generally easy to manage with the right clothing. Nights drop to 6°C (43°F). Cold nights like these are actually great for sleeping well, as long as you have a warm enough duvet. On average, it is the month with the highest temperature of the year.

What to Wear in Hjerkinn in July

The weather can swing between comfortable and chilly in July, so flexibility is key. Pack a variety of tops, at least one warm layer, and both shorts and long pants. This gives you options no matter what the day brings. Expect heavy rainfall, so bring good rain protection and waterproof bags.
